Overview

Leather cutting blades are essential tools in industries that require precise and efficient cutting of leather materials. These blades are designed to handle the toughness of leather while maintaining a sharp edge for clean cuts. They are widely used in shoemaking, upholstery, and the production of leather goods such as bags, belts, and jackets. The quality of a leather cutting blade depends on its material and design. High-carbon steel blades are common for their balance of sharpness and durability, while tungsten carbide and ceramic blades offer superior wear resistance for heavy-duty applications. The choice of blade often depends on the specific requirements of the task, including the thickness and type of leather being cut.

Structure and Working Principle

Leather cutting blades typically feature a sharp, straight or curved edge designed to slice through leather with minimal resistance. The blade's geometry is crucial for achieving precise cuts, with some designs optimized for specific cutting techniques, such as skiving or trimming. The working principle involves applying force to the blade, which then cleanly separates the leather fibers. The blade's sharpness and material play a significant role in reducing friction and preventing tearing. For industrial applications, these blades are often mounted on cutting machines, which provide consistent pressure and movement to ensure uniform cuts.

Key Features

One of the standout features of leather cutting blades is their sharpness, which is maintained over prolonged use due to high-quality materials. High-carbon steel blades, for example, can be sharpened repeatedly, extending their lifespan. Another key feature is durability. Tungsten carbide and ceramic blades are particularly resistant to wear, making them ideal for high-volume cutting operations. Additionally, some blades are coated with non-stick materials to reduce friction and prevent leather from sticking to the blade during cutting.

Application Areas

Leather cutting blades are indispensable in various industries. In shoemaking, they are used to cut leather for soles, uppers, and other components. Upholstery professionals rely on these blades to shape leather for furniture, car interiors, and aviation seats. Beyond industrial uses, leather cutting blades are also popular among hobbyists and craftsmen who create custom leather goods. The blades' precision and versatility make them suitable for intricate designs and detailed work, such as engraving or embossing leather.

Maintenance and Precautions

Proper maintenance is essential to prolong the life of leather cutting blades. Regular sharpening is necessary to maintain their edge, especially for high-carbon steel blades. Tungsten carbide and ceramic blades require less frequent sharpening but should be handled carefully to avoid chipping. Storage is another critical factor. Blades should be kept in a dry environment to prevent rust and corrosion. When not in use, covering the blade or storing it in a protective sheath can prevent accidental injuries and damage to the cutting edge.

B2B Procurement Guide

When procuring leather cutting blades in bulk, consider the material compatibility with your existing machinery. High-carbon steel blades are cost-effective for general use, while tungsten carbide or ceramic blades may be more suitable for heavy-duty applications. It's also important to evaluate suppliers based on their reputation, quality control measures, and ability to provide consistent products. Requesting samples before large purchases can help ensure the blades meet your specific requirements. Additionally, consider the supplier's lead times and after-sales support to avoid disruptions in your production process.
